
After the keys were laser cut and programmed by a locksmith, the key worked as advertised. The locksmith charged us $25. I didn't want to spend $50 on both so I have an extra form in case I need it. I tried to get an offer from the dealer but they wouldn't give me one. Assuming they know that if you ask you probably have a plan B and know their prices will be higher. Programming is easy, there are videos on the net, but the car owner does it. The process only works if you have a good key, otherwise you will have to go to the dealer. What you do is put a known working key in the ignition and turn it on, but won't start the truck. After all the initialization indicators come on, remove the key and do the same with the new key. It must be programmed at this point.
